LaMelo Ball's contract with the Charlotte Hornets grades as a B+ CVI — the team is getting good return on this investment relative to other point guards around the league. LaMelo's on-court production grades out in the upper tier of NBA point guards, grading him as an elite performer at the position. His $38.0M average annual value ranks as high-end money for the point guard market. The production-to-cost ratio is favorable — solid output at a reasonable price point represents good asset management. At 24, LaMelo has years of development ahead, which adds significant upside to this contract. The 4-year contract represents a moderate investment with room to exit if needed.
LaMelo Ball is playing at an elite level this season, earning an A Performance grade. Among NBA point guards, he's producing at an All-Star or All-NBA caliber. He's averaging 20.1 points, 4.8 rebounds, and 7.1 assists through 303 games — carrying a significant offensive load. LaMelo's strongest area is APG at 7.1, which compares favorably to the point guard median of 4.0. The biggest area for growth is FG% at 40.7 (point guard median: 46.0). Among 93 NBA point guards graded this season, LaMelo ranks 7th. As a ROY talent at just 24, LaMelo's development trajectory suggests the best is yet to come for the Charlotte Hornets.

LaMelo Ball is respected as a talented playmaker with B+ production and recent Player of the Week honors. His long-range shooting and playmaking skills generate positive media coverage and fan appreciation. Injury management remains a minor concern, but doesn't significantly damage his standing. At five years experience with solid PER of 19.5, he's viewed as a quality starter and franchise asset. Overall perception is positive despite not reaching MVP-candidate status or superstar elite tier.
